{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":32775082,"defaultBranch":"main","name":"phoenix_live_reload","ownerLogin":"phoenixframework","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2015-03-24T03:57:55.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/6510388?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1711544661.0","currentOid":""},"activityList":{"items":[{"before":"e5e21361d615e4452ae6b4b68c6b94fbb3626241","after":"c6dea191262f50a307a2a50196df270d1e638de5","ref":"refs/heads/main","pushedAt":"2024-04-29T06:39:01.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"josevalim","name":"José Valim","path":"/josevalim","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9582?s=80&v=4"},"commit":{"message":"Allow WebConsoleLogger to shutdown cleanly (#159)\n\nThis avoids a race condition: a log message might come in after we've\r\ncalled `WebConsoleLogger.attach_logger()` and before the Registry is\r\nstarted.","shortMessageHtmlLink":"Allow WebConsoleLogger to shutdown cleanly (#159)"}},{"before":"a851d314957f8056ad7fbaa1127121214d2a4e0a","after":"e5e21361d615e4452ae6b4b68c6b94fbb3626241","ref":"refs/heads/main","pushedAt":"2024-04-17T17:31:55.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"josevalim","name":"José Valim","path":"/josevalim","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9582?s=80&v=4"},"commit":{"message":"web logger: use the appropriate console function level (#158)","shortMessageHtmlLink":"web logger: use the appropriate console function level (#158)"}},{"before":"f230d9c217e48cffc3af1bccd6e368ecad7b1dad","after":"a851d314957f8056ad7fbaa1127121214d2a4e0a","ref":"refs/heads/main","pushedAt":"2024-03-27T13:04:15.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"josevalim","name":"José Valim","path":"/josevalim","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9582?s=80&v=4"},"commit":{"message":"Release v1.5.3","shortMessageHtmlLink":"Release v1.5.3"}},{"before":"49aaddaf680004b2e53355e322daa604987b7c38","after":"f230d9c217e48cffc3af1bccd6e368ecad7b1dad","ref":"refs/heads/main","pushedAt":"2024-03-27T13:02:37.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"josevalim","name":"José Valim","path":"/josevalim","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9582?s=80&v=4"},"commit":{"message":"Make debug level messages readable in light mode (#156)\n\nChange cyan to darkcyan","shortMessageHtmlLink":"Make debug level messages readable in light mode (#156)"}},{"before":"f3796ab06f0213e829eb979c27753b7f0c58a6a7","after":"49aaddaf680004b2e53355e322daa604987b7c38","ref":"refs/heads/main","pushedAt":"2024-03-24T16:49:32.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"josevalim","name":"José Valim","path":"/josevalim","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9582?s=80&v=4"},"commit":{"message":"Remove undefined warning on earlier Elixir versions\n\nCloses #157.","shortMessageHtmlLink":"Remove undefined warning on earlier Elixir versions"}},{"before":"c125dbabdacaa07ddad66a283962703648834fe3","after":"f3796ab06f0213e829eb979c27753b7f0c58a6a7","ref":"refs/heads/main","pushedAt":"2024-03-11T18:43:01.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"},"commit":{"message":"Release 1.5.2","shortMessageHtmlLink":"Release 1.5.2"}},{"before":"e7805facb77222b7e56ff4845e70f885c10874a9","after":"c125dbabdacaa07ddad66a283962703648834fe3","ref":"refs/heads/main","pushedAt":"2024-03-11T18:41:44.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"},"commit":{"message":"Prevent dup level","shortMessageHtmlLink":"Prevent dup level"}},{"before":"815aab606c240781b63fed03a9ba5ad80a3cfa78","after":"e7805facb77222b7e56ff4845e70f885c10874a9","ref":"refs/heads/main","pushedAt":"2024-03-11T18:27:18.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"},"commit":{"message":"Merge pull request #150 from joshamb/main\n\nHandle more log types (ie notice)","shortMessageHtmlLink":"Merge pull request #150 from joshamb/main"}},{"before":"71f0ee2ce0fee27ad70da62e23d62bebf71daad0","after":"815aab606c240781b63fed03a9ba5ad80a3cfa78","ref":"refs/heads/main","pushedAt":"2024-03-11T12:22:41.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"},"commit":{"message":"Merge pull request #153 from walkr/patch-1\n\nUpdate css reload strategy","shortMessageHtmlLink":"Merge pull request #153 from walkr/patch-1"}},{"before":"5d51a1122cd03a18ac13be5f1f0161208518503e","after":"71f0ee2ce0fee27ad70da62e23d62bebf71daad0","ref":"refs/heads/main","pushedAt":"2024-03-11T08:45:48.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"josevalim","name":"José Valim","path":"/josevalim","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9582?s=80&v=4"},"commit":{"message":"Do not send the whole metadata across processes","shortMessageHtmlLink":"Do not send the whole metadata across processes"}},{"before":"700fef3233411fdaba78f5c1094ca04fd6df466d","after":null,"ref":"refs/heads/sd-deps-path","pushedAt":"2024-03-07T16:59:37.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"josevalim","name":"José Valim","path":"/josevalim","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9582?s=80&v=4"}},{"before":"e23ad332527297b3c33c31d06aa324b26b0fe01a","after":"5d51a1122cd03a18ac13be5f1f0161208518503e","ref":"refs/heads/main","pushedAt":"2024-03-07T16:59:32.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"josevalim","name":"José Valim","path":"/josevalim","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9582?s=80&v=4"},"commit":{"message":"load dependencies in application start callback (#151)\n\nWhen using the new PLUG_EDITOR integration, there was a problem where\r\nnot all dependencies were available when the code reloader recompiled\r\nthe code.\r\nThis lead to missing dependencies when the live reloader joined the\r\nchannel.\r\nThis change ensures that all we initially load the deps when the\r\napplication starts, so that later recompiles don't affect the deps list.","shortMessageHtmlLink":"load dependencies in application start callback (#151)"}},{"before":"56e5100b599ddb34565b394f1c2c4227fa2e5d9a","after":"700fef3233411fdaba78f5c1094ca04fd6df466d","ref":"refs/heads/sd-deps-path","pushedAt":"2024-03-07T16:03:04.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"SteffenDE","name":"Steffen Deusch","path":"/SteffenDE","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/4116351?s=80&v=4"},"commit":{"message":"load dependencies in application start callback\n\nWhen using the new PLUG_EDITOR integration, there was a problem where\nnot all dependencies were available when the code reloader recompiled\nthe code.\nThis lead to missing dependencies when the live reloader joined the\nchannel.\nThis change ensures that all we initially load the deps when the\napplication starts, so that later recompiles don't affect the deps list.","shortMessageHtmlLink":"load dependencies in application start callback"}},{"before":null,"after":"56e5100b599ddb34565b394f1c2c4227fa2e5d9a","ref":"refs/heads/sd-deps-path","pushedAt":"2024-03-07T14:43:22.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"SteffenDE","name":"Steffen Deusch","path":"/SteffenDE","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/4116351?s=80&v=4"},"commit":{"message":"load dependencies in application start callback\n\nWhen using the new PLUG_EDITOR integration, there was a problem where\nnot all dependencies were available when the code reloader recompiled\nthe code.\nThis lead to missing dependencies when the live reloader joined the\nchannel.\nThis change ensures that all we initially load the deps when the\napplication starts, so that later recompiles don't affect the deps list.","shortMessageHtmlLink":"load dependencies in application start callback"}},{"before":"181c349d37e35653dc48923a95797eb0423d8bbe","after":"e23ad332527297b3c33c31d06aa324b26b0fe01a","ref":"refs/heads/main","pushedAt":"2024-03-04T10:46:46.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"josevalim","name":"José Valim","path":"/josevalim","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9582?s=80&v=4"},"commit":{"message":"Release v1.5.1","shortMessageHtmlLink":"Release v1.5.1"}},{"before":"2166f18090004beea0e8a3de25522d20f97d31e1","after":"181c349d37e35653dc48923a95797eb0423d8bbe","ref":"refs/heads/main","pushedAt":"2024-03-01T10:32:44.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"josevalim","name":"José Valim","path":"/josevalim","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9582?s=80&v=4"},"commit":{"message":"Fix typo (#148)","shortMessageHtmlLink":"Fix typo (#148)"}},{"before":"f434a1368f51552b4c89ea81088b0ae511ebf79b","after":"2166f18090004beea0e8a3de25522d20f97d31e1","ref":"refs/heads/main","pushedAt":"2024-02-29T20:27:53.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"},"commit":{"message":"Release 1.5.0","shortMessageHtmlLink":"Release 1.5.0"}},{"before":"80e6b5d2d28b468ed249a4dd79cf3a6356a42389","after":null,"ref":"refs/heads/cm-web-logger","pushedAt":"2024-02-29T16:02:59.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"}},{"before":"13d89ca4178bc9f77d4b930d47046e47758f7128","after":"f434a1368f51552b4c89ea81088b0ae511ebf79b","ref":"refs/heads/main","pushedAt":"2024-02-29T16:02:56.000Z","pushType":"pr_merge","commitsCount":16,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"},"commit":{"message":"Merge pull request #147 from phoenixframework/cm-web-logger\n\nAdd web console logger and open file from client support","shortMessageHtmlLink":"Merge pull request #147 from phoenixframework/cm-web-logger"}},{"before":"d7039e4c44219a31fec62078a842addd3714d5a5","after":"80e6b5d2d28b468ed249a4dd79cf3a6356a42389","ref":"refs/heads/cm-web-logger","pushedAt":"2024-02-28T17:09:01.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"},"commit":{"message":"s/connected/attached","shortMessageHtmlLink":"s/connected/attached"}},{"before":"e6078a26c276f0eb75d0e9818a926cea84b77953","after":"d7039e4c44219a31fec62078a842addd3714d5a5","ref":"refs/heads/cm-web-logger","pushedAt":"2024-02-27T22:16:37.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"},"commit":{"message":"Remove unused join key","shortMessageHtmlLink":"Remove unused join key"}},{"before":"759a2fcbc9fdd91409da40ea144b17601b8c6811","after":"e6078a26c276f0eb75d0e9818a926cea84b77953","ref":"refs/heads/cm-web-logger","pushedAt":"2024-02-27T22:15:50.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"},"commit":{"message":"Guard Mix.Project at runtime","shortMessageHtmlLink":"Guard Mix.Project at runtime"}},{"before":"45c0f036d93f0df1b4632f9b39616eb46e8af57f","after":"759a2fcbc9fdd91409da40ea144b17601b8c6811","ref":"refs/heads/cm-web-logger","pushedAt":"2024-02-27T21:34:25.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"},"commit":{"message":"Support umbrellas and deps","shortMessageHtmlLink":"Support umbrellas and deps"}},{"before":"8ef154b00c09715edfdda15bbc4e6afbc9a59b50","after":"45c0f036d93f0df1b4632f9b39616eb46e8af57f","ref":"refs/heads/cm-web-logger","pushedAt":"2024-02-27T18:42:03.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"},"commit":{"message":"openEditorAtCaller and openEditorAtDef","shortMessageHtmlLink":"openEditorAtCaller and openEditorAtDef"}},{"before":"c3b13a1049834a0751b973073e1ba477bec03f68","after":"8ef154b00c09715edfdda15bbc4e6afbc9a59b50","ref":"refs/heads/cm-web-logger","pushedAt":"2024-02-26T20:17:33.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"},"commit":{"message":"PLUG_EDITOR","shortMessageHtmlLink":"PLUG_EDITOR"}},{"before":"d2775ff46b87250801e6559e3b385d1eefde13da","after":"c3b13a1049834a0751b973073e1ba477bec03f68","ref":"refs/heads/cm-web-logger","pushedAt":"2024-02-23T17:42:12.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"},"commit":{"message":"better error","shortMessageHtmlLink":"better error"}},{"before":"0e71243955a192c75ed1009224921c987ab74d20","after":"d2775ff46b87250801e6559e3b385d1eefde13da","ref":"refs/heads/cm-web-logger","pushedAt":"2024-02-23T17:39:22.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"},"commit":{"message":"Only support ELIXIR_EDITOR_URL export and warn if missing on openEditor","shortMessageHtmlLink":"Only support ELIXIR_EDITOR_URL export and warn if missing on openEditor"}},{"before":"08e919d1d3462e984d7a13e653a3a5db184451e8","after":"0e71243955a192c75ed1009224921c987ab74d20","ref":"refs/heads/cm-web-logger","pushedAt":"2024-02-23T16:05:59.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"},"commit":{"message":"Fix docs","shortMessageHtmlLink":"Fix docs"}},{"before":"fcd3c2c02ea6c3fe5b1d4ba3589805db261aa4d7","after":"08e919d1d3462e984d7a13e653a3a5db184451e8","ref":"refs/heads/cm-web-logger","pushedAt":"2024-02-23T16:02:46.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"},"commit":{"message":"Refactor based on feedback","shortMessageHtmlLink":"Refactor based on feedback"}},{"before":"835e7400a8858e033cffed7d6a90bf9cf96678c8","after":"fcd3c2c02ea6c3fe5b1d4ba3589805db261aa4d7","ref":"refs/heads/cm-web-logger","pushedAt":"2024-02-23T03:55:14.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"chrismccord","name":"Chris McCord","path":"/chrismccord","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/576796?s=80&v=4"},"commit":{"message":"Docs","shortMessageHtmlLink":"Docs"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AEPKeTOgA","startCursor":null,"endCursor":null}},"title":"Activity · phoenixframework/phoenix_live_reload"}